VOSS v. ASSOCIATED LIFE INSURANCE CO.

No. 75-55.

36 Ill. App.3d 105 (1976)

343 N.E.2d 174

RALPH F. VOSS, Plaintiff-Appellee, v. ASSOCIATED LIFE INSURANCE COMPANY, Defendant-Appellant.

Appellate Court of Illinois — Fifth District.

Rehearing denied March 23, 1976.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Cornelius Thomas Ducey, Jr., of Ducey and Feder, Ltd., of Belleville, for appellant.

Dixon, Starnes, Nester, McDonnell & Stegmeyer, of Belleville (Joseph B. McDonnell, of counsel), for appellee.


Judgment reversed.

Mr. JUSTICE EBERSPACHER delivered the opinion of the court:

This is an appeal by the defendant, Associated Life Insurance Company, from a judgment in the amount of $7,200 entered by the circuit court of St. Clair County on a jury verdict in favor of the plaintiff, Ralph F. Voss.
